Abstract
The influence of oxygen pressure on the photoelectrocatalytic oxidation of phenol on TiO2/Ti and Pt-TiO2/Ti photoelectrodes under UV and visible light irradiation is investigated. It is shown that, as the oxygen pressure increases from 0.1 to 0.7 MPa, the rate of the process rises about 1.1 times.
